Hello, my laptop which is a HP pavilion dv6, running windows 8.1 (64-bit) with 6gb ram and i5. The problem is that the sound is not working due to the fact that the sound icon is showing a X (cross) red mark saying "no speakers or audio devices are plugged in". I went to playback devices and tried to enable it but it doesn't show the option to enable- as if its showing it is enabled already. But i double clicked it and showed that it was disabled in the enhancements (Status: Disabled). I also went in to the Device Manager to see if it was disabled there. However, it wasn't disabled there either. Although i did try to disable and enable it just to see if its working, but sadly it didn't. Please help me as much as you can.. dear community!
